About The Position

This role supports the Legal & Compliance Department by helping attorneys manage legal processes, conduct research, review documents, and support transactional work. The position focuses on organizing and preparing legal materials, analyzing issues with low to moderate complexity, and ensuring compliance with state and federal requirements. Work is performed with growing independence and frequent interaction across teams and business units.

Responsibilities

  • Review, organize, and prepare legal documents and agreements.
  • Conduct legal research and analyze statutes, regulations, and case law.
  • Support attorneys with business inquiries, transactions, and special projects.
  • Evaluate legal process requests and identify relevant issues.
  • Maintain accurate document management and ensure compliance with legal standards.
